Subtract 15/25 from 70/60
1st number: 1 10/60, 2nd number: 15/25
70/60 - 15/25 is 17/30.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 60 and 25 is 300
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 300 - For the 1st fraction, since 60 × 5 = 300,
70/60 = 70 × 5/60 × 5 = 350/300 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 25 × 12 = 300,
15/25 = 15 × 12/25 × 12 = 180/300 - Subtract the two like fractions:
350/300 - 180/300 = 350 - 180/300 = 170/300 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 17/30
